Lee Residence (USA)
Building a sprawling modern masterpiece in 3D requires precision: complex gables, precise brickwork, and seamless material transitions. The Lee Residence showcase highlights dedicated architectural asset modeling for high-end, multi-winged residential developments.
When dealing with large-scale, multi-winged home designs, maintaining structural accuracy across intersecting rooflines, gable angles, and window placements is critical before moving to construction.
Project Overview & Key Architectural Features
1.Multi-Gable Roof Architecture: Precision-modeled intersecting rooflines, complex gable angles, and seamless soffit transitions across a multi-winged residential footprint.
2.Dual Garage Wing Composition: Custom geometry setup aligning two separate garage wings with the main home structure to maintain proportion and visual symmetry.
3.High-End Material Texturing: Accurate texture mapping featuring clean white brick cladding, horizontal siding, timber accents, and dark architectural window framing.
4.Custom Fenestration & Opening Layouts: Precise placement and scale of large-format glass windows and sliding doors for optimized natural light modeling.
CAD Software & Visualization Tools
1.Primary CAD Software: Structure Studios (Vip3D)
2.Key Capabilities Applied: Complex roofline modeling, geometric massing, realistic material texture mapping, and high-precision building dimensioning.
3.Deliverables: High-resolution 3D architectural exterior renderings, conceptual massing models, material presentation graphics, and construction-ready visual assets.
